
Parc d'Atraccions Tibidabo is a historic family amusement park perched atop the Tibidabo mountain overlooking Barcelona, Spain. One of the oldest operating amusement parks in the world, it combines classic fairground rides and shows with one of the most spectacular panoramic viewpoints the city has to offer. Guests arrive via the iconic Cuca de Llum funicular railway, which was fully renovated in 2021, adding a charming new dimension to the visit. The park features a broad selection of rides and live entertainment suitable for all ages, alongside dining options including the recently opened Masia Tibidabo restaurant by acclaimed chef Rafa Zafra.
